Inexperienced users put excessive pressure on the body in the hammer mode, forgetting that the bit works due to the force of the internal mechanism, the amplitude of the striker stroke decreases, leading to its breakage; A change in the bit trajectory with a certain deepening of the working body into the destroyed material leads to wear of the piston, striker, bearings, and crank assembly; Overheating of the tool during prolonged use in difficult conditions is fraught with shearing of the gear teeth. The rubber rings of the striker, striker, piston are worn out; The cylinder collapsed, the firing pin of the percussion mechanism barrel; Cut the splines of the clutch mounted on the intermediate shaft; Mechanical damage to striking elements (firing pin or clutch).
